Fume Extraction System The two types of Fume Extraction System are as follows -
(1) Continuous pickling lines of the closed type for strips and wires.
(2) Batch pickling lines of the open type for wire coils, straight tube bundles, automobile bodies (surface pretreatment prior to painting) etc.
Induced draft type fume extraction systems are adopted for the former and push-pull type systems are used for the latter. The surface treatment solutions could be hydrochloric acid, sulfuric acid, hydrofluoric acid, nitric acid, chromic acid or any other at various concentrations and temperatures. The design of the system is aimed at protection of the operating personnel on the one side and protection of the environment by controlling emissions. Temperature, concentration and toxicity and partial pressures of the vapors are considerations in system design. Pharmaceutical Plants Fume Extraction System Several toxic chemicals are used in the manufacturing of pharma products. Also they generate several highly toxic gases such as NH3, HCl, HF, NOx, SO2, Cl2, HBr, Br2, H2S, HCN, HCHO and other organic and inorganic gases. The emissions from the plant have also to be controlled. As the gases generated are of different types the solutions to be used for absorbing them will also be different. As it would be expensive to use many absorption systems, the reactors are grouped into two or more groups for the purpose of providing fume extraction systems. The systems cover everything from retractable fume hoods near reactors to protect personnel to final absorbers and stacks. Tray Type Gas Absorbers We design and manufacture special tray-type absorbers for acid regeneration plants. The spent acid containing chlorides of iron is oxidized in a fluidized bed reactor to produce iron oxide and HCl vapours. Whereas iron oxide is a useful bye-product, the HCl is absorbed in stoichiometric quantities of water to obtain 17 to 20% hydrochloric acid and reused for pickling. Finally the gases are passed through columns to limit emissions within pollution control limits.

Hypochlorite Production Plants The reaction is exothermic and wet chlorine is highly corrosive requiring coolers and special materials of construction. Often sodium hypochlorite is produced in caustic chlorine plants by the absorption of chlorine gas in sodium hydroxide. We can manufacture and supply these plants on turn-key basis.

Mixer - Settlers The mixers will have special type of variable speed agitators for transfer of liquids. Mixer-settlers are used for liquid-liquid solvent extraction for purposes such as separation of nuclear chemicals and other metallurgical separations.
